Output b20d83f0601dea3691a6806f321dbfc472c19ff00a9620f267aa3bb7b3c6e942:6

value
505841
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90181a26d03daf7c0e4fb5ba3b277804c77894f0 OP_EQUAL
address
3Epv6pBukiwfBWxo1HzJxjFQbabNr1yDwa
transaction
b20d83f0601dea3691a6806f321dbfc472c19ff00a9620f267aa3bb7b3c6e942
confirmations
228549
spent
true